Taman Tunas Muda in Barat Daya, Penang recorded 10 subsale transactions in 2023, with a median price of RM348K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M301.

This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 47 residential properties or 1 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M348K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M150K to RM662K, and a typical market range of RM150K to RM558K.

Most transactions involved flats, with high diversity across multiple property types.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M301, though individual units vary from RM201 to RM401 in the core range. The broader market spans RM232.60 to RM369.60,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M137.00) and deviation (MAD: RM100)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
